摘要
Many e-book applications have been available on the mobile devices in the recent decade. People read the electronic contents on their mobile devices. Meanwhile, a variety of mobile device platforms have emerged in the market. To make the e-book content compatible on different mobile device platforms, the layout or e-book application design needs to be adjusted based on the display resolution. However, different resolution settings are available in the mobile devices. For example, Android can runs on a variety of devices that offer different screen sizes. Android also can support different resolutions from 320*240 to 1280*720. Hence, the resolution becomes a critical problem for e-book content provider. Besides, image scaling is another problem for e-book applications. If the e-book application load bitmap images as its contents, the bitmap contents may be distorted when user scales up the size of contents or images. Therefore, the different resolutions and image scaling are two important issues in the design of e-book application. Vector graphic library can solve the above problems. However, vector graphic has bad performance in mobile devices and just few e-book contents are available in vector graphic format. Hence, file format conversion is another high-cost task in e-book with vector graphic. This paper proposes a cloud system integrating an e-book reader with vector graphic technology, called CloudVG. CloudVG optimizes the vector graphic library through a Renderscript method and offloads the conversion of bitmap to vector format on cloud platform. The experiment results show CloudVG can achieve 250% performance improvement over the original library and the procedure of file format conversion can achieve a near-linear speedup on cloud computing platforms.
